Mermaids

  • Writer: Andrew Bedell
    Andrew Bedell
  • Jun 11, 2017
  • 1 min read

I’ve been waiting for a sign

An indication to show that you care

I don’t even know whether you are here anymore

You are in the room

I could reach out and touch you

But you seem so far away

You never even talk to me these days

And a picture can tell a thousand lies

Sometimes its difficult keeping sane

At times I feel as though I’m falling apart

Like I’m all at sea

But sooner or later

I guess we are all washed up

Just lost souls stranded on the shore

I wish I could breath beneath the ocean

I want to party with the mermaids

To visit their secret lair

It would be good to be aquatic

I could leave the land behind

Onwards into the abyss.
